Summary

The Grand Jury voted to indict Don Lemon after he covered a protest at a church in Minnesota, not President Trump. Don Lemon has since been released without bail in connection with the Minnesota protest. Mark discusses whether the Grammys truly embraced DEI (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ion) this year. Mark interviews Boston radio host Howie Carr. Howie shares his thoughts on the upcoming midterms and why he believes Republicans will not lose. They also speculate about which political figure might be the next to make headlines like Don Lemon. Some Democrats may push for a serious investigation into the Clintons, as newer members of the party are unfamiliar with the Clintons’ past. Mark also talks about the prestigious Alfalfa Dinner, known for its behind-the-scenes political discussions in the U.S. Mark interviews radio legend Scott Shannon. Together, they recap last night’s Grammy Awards, with a special mention of Bad Bunny’s positive presence at the event. They also debate who is more likely to win the Super Bowl this year- the Patriots or the Seahawks- and discuss the liberal press’s efforts to undermine the new Melania movie.
